I know someone who is looking for a young and bright analyst to work for a USA consulting start-up. The hours are flexible, and may even allow working from home.

Qualifications The nature of work will be complex analysis and modeling. Actuarial students preferred (those with 1+ exams), Accounting or A-Levels with mathematics also a good fit. Statistical courses/knowledge a definite plus. Excel proficiency required, MySQL experience preferred though not required.

Offer Will be negotiable. Salary is expected to be typical to entry-level, though slingshot salary/career growth can be expected if the venture succeeds.
